What is childhood trauma?
Childhood trauma refers to distressing experiences that negatively impact a child’s mental and emotional well-being, such as abuse, neglect, or witnessing violence.
How does ACE support young people?
ACE provides personalized therapy and counseling services tailored to the unique needs of each young person, helping them build resilience and improve mental health.
Can families receive support from ACE?
Yes, ACE offers support to families of children and young people in our programs, fostering a collaborative approach to healing and recovery.
How can I refer someone to ACE?
Referrals can be made by professionals, parents, carers, or the young people themselves through our website or by contacting our team directly.
